About 10 Druid Close

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

10 Druid Close is a five-bedroom detached house in Stoke Bishop, Bristol, Bristol (BS9 1RZ). It has a recorded floor area of 152 m² (around 1636 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(March 2014)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77). The latest certificate is from March 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ory.

One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2003. Past consents include an extension and a conservatory,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 1997–2018,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£1,010,000 is 23.9% above the 2018 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£498/sq ft) was about 197.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 8 years since the last transfer (February 2018).
